Package com.foxinmy.weixin4j.model.card
Class MemberCard
- java.lang.Object
-
- com.foxinmy.weixin4j.model.card.CardCoupon
-
- com.foxinmy.weixin4j.model.card.MemberCard
-
public class MemberCard extends CardCoupon
会员卡
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
MemberCard.Builder
-
Constructor Summary
Constructors Modifier Constructor Description protected
MemberCard(CouponBaseInfo couponBaseInfo, MemberCard.Builder builder)
卡券
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getActivateUrl()
String
getBackgroundPicUrl()
String
getBalanceRules()
String
getBalanceUrl()
String
getBonusCleared()
MemCardBonusRule
getBonusRule()
String
getBonusRules()
String
getBonusUrl()
CardType
getCardType()
卡券类型MemCardCustomField
getCustomCell1()
MemCardCustomField
getCustomField1()
MemCardCustomField
getCustomField2()
MemCardCustomField
getCustomField3()
int
getDiscount()
String
getPrerogative()
boolean
getSupplyBalance()
boolean
isAutoActivate()
boolean
isSupplyBonus()
boolean
isWxActivate()
-
Methods inherited from class com.foxinmy.weixin4j.model.card.CardCoupon
cleanCantUpdateField, getCouponAdvanceInfo, getCouponBaseInfo, setCouponAdvanceInfo, toString
-
-
-
-
Constructor Detail
-
MemberCard
protected MemberCard(CouponBaseInfo couponBaseInfo, MemberCard.Builder builder)
卡券- Parameters:
couponBaseInfo
- 基础信息
-
-
Method Detail
-
getCardType
public CardType getCardType()
Description copied from class:CardCoupon
卡券类型- Specified by:
getCardType
in classCardCoupon
- Returns:
-
getBackgroundPicUrl
public String getBackgroundPicUrl()
-
getPrerogative
public String getPrerogative()
-
isAutoActivate
public boolean isAutoActivate()
-
isWxActivate
public boolean isWxActivate()
-
getActivateUrl
public String getActivateUrl()
-
isSupplyBonus
public boolean isSupplyBonus()
-
getBonusUrl
public String getBonusUrl()
-
getSupplyBalance
public boolean getSupplyBalance()
-
getBalanceUrl
public String getBalanceUrl()
-
getCustomField1
public MemCardCustomField getCustomField1()
-
getCustomField2
public MemCardCustomField getCustomField2()
-
getCustomField3
public MemCardCustomField getCustomField3()
-
getBonusRules
public String getBonusRules()
-
getBalanceRules
public String getBalanceRules()
-
getBonusCleared
public String getBonusCleared()
-
getCustomCell1
public MemCardCustomField getCustomCell1()
-
getDiscount
public int getDiscount()
-
getBonusRule
public MemCardBonusRule getBonusRule()
-
-